Kiri and Lou is a gentle and heartwarming stop-motion animated series for preschoolers. It follows the adventures of Kiri, a curious and energetic creature, and her best friend Lou, a soft and thoughtful monster. Together, they explore their vibrant world, learning about friendship, emotions, and the wonders of nature through playful activities and problem-solving.
Kiri and Lou has been widely praised for its charming animation, gentle storytelling, and positive messages for young children. It is recognized for its commitment to inclusivity and its ability to engage preschoolers with calm and thoughtful narratives.

The unique stop-motion animation style for Kiri and Lou is created using 3D printing technology to design and then individually pose and animate each character and set piece.
